From: Christophe Fergeau Date: Wed, 19 Sep 2012 15:00:55 +0000 (+0200) Subject: build: fix detection of netcf linked with libnl1 X-Git-Url: http://xenbits.xensource.com/gitweb?a=commitdiff_plain;h=f6c295156672fe15b32d2baddb68957bb7bddd8e;p=people%2Fliuw%2Flibxenctrl-split%2Flibvirt.git build: fix detection of netcf linked with libnl1 Commit 9298bfbcb introduced code to detect if netcf is linked with libnl1, and to prefer libnl1 over libnl3 when this is the case. This behaviour can be disabled by setting LIBNL_CFLAGS to any value, including the empty string. However, configure.ac sets LIBNL_CFLAGS to "" before attempting libnl detection, so the libnl1 detection code is always disabled. This caused issues on my f17 system where netcf is linked with libnl1 but libvirt got built with libnl3. This commit removes the setting of the LIBNL_* variables to "" as this does not appear to be needed.
